Web.xml文件中的context-param配置用于定義應用程序的初始化參數。這些參數可以在整個應用程序中使用,并且可以在需要時進行修改。在Web應用程序中,context-param可以用于配置一些全局的參數,例如數據庫連接的URL、用戶名和密碼,或者其他配置信息。
這些參數可以在應用程序的任何地方通過ServletContext對象進行訪問。通過使用ServletContext對象的getInitParameter()方法,可以獲取在web.xml文件中配置的context-param的值。
例如,在web.xml文件中配置了一個名為"databaseURL"的context-param:
<context-param>
<param-name>databaseURL</param-name>
<param-value>jdbc:mysql://localhost:3306/mydb</param-value>
</context-param>
然后,在應用程序的任何地方,可以通過ServletContext對象獲取這個參數的值:
String databaseURL = getServletContext().getInitParameter("databaseURL");
這樣,可以方便地在應用程序中訪問和修改這些全局的配置參數,而不需要硬編碼在代碼中。這種方式可以提高應用程序的可維護性和靈活性。